Linda Duncan is the paternal grandmother of PJ, Teddy, Gabe, Charlie and Toby. She’s the mother of Bob and the ex-wife of Frank. She made her first real appearance in Welcome Home and a gag appearance in Dress Mess. She’s portrayed by Shirley Jones. She lives in Phoenix, Arizona. Jones's work has been widely exhibited, including solo retrospective exhibitions at the Victoria and Albert …Shirley Jones is an American actress and singer. In her six decades in show business, she has starred as wholesome characters in a number of musical films, such as "Oklahoma!" (1955), "Carousel" (1956), and "The Music Man" (1962). She won the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ress for playing a vengeful prostitute in "Elmer Gantry" (1960). She …

Then & Now is a studio album by American singer Shirley Jones of The Partridge Family pop music group. The album is a half retrospective collection featuring 14 tracks from her movie musicals while the other 10 tracks are new studio recordings. [1] The album was released in the fall of 2008 on Stage Door Records.
